The Thyroid Gland

4.1K
The thyroid gland is a small, butterfly-shaped gland located in the neck and covers the anterior surface of the trachea. The gland has two lateral lobes connected by a thin tissue mass called the isthmus. Internally, each lobe comprises many small spherical structures known as thyroid follicles, surrounded by a network of blood vessels.

Thyroid Teratoma in a Pediatric Patient.

Meera R Laxman1, Laura L Hayes2, Santino S Cervantes3

  • 1Pediatric Surgery, Nemours Children's Hospital, Orlando, USA.

Cureus
|October 28, 2022
PubMed
Summary

Congenital thyroid teratomas, rare tumors in children, can cause airway issues. Early surgical removal is recommended for these growths, as seen in a case of a two-year-old girl.

Area of Science:

  • Pediatric Surgery
  • Endocrinology
  • Oncology

Background:

  • Congenital teratomas are rare germ cell tumors.
  • Extragonadal teratomas most commonly occur in the sacrococcygeal region.
  • Head and neck teratomas represent a small percentage (1-6%) of pediatric teratomas.

Observation:

  • A case report of a two-year-old female presenting with a large thyroid mass.
  • The patient underwent laryngoscopy and right thyroid lobectomy.
  • The mass was identified as a congenital thyroid teratoma.

Findings:

  • Congenital thyroid teratoma is an exceptionally rare diagnosis.
  • Surgical excision is the recommended treatment due to risks of airway compromise and malignancy.
  • This case highlights a rare presentation of a teratoma in the thyroid gland.

Implications:

  • Early diagnosis and surgical intervention are crucial for congenital thyroid teratomas.
  • This case contributes to understanding the management of rare pediatric head and neck tumors.
  • Further research may elucidate the specific etiology and optimal long-term surveillance for these rare tumors.
